A 24-aa standard natural multi-activity (Antibacterial, Anticancer, Antifungal, and other sources) peptide sequence curated from AntiBP3, dbAMP, DRAMP, and other sources, with an available 3D structural model.
Sequence
FLPVLAGIAAKVVPALFCKITKKC

dbAMP DRAMP

Other

Active against B. Subtilis (MIC 2 ug/ml), S. aureus (MIC 8 ug/ml), and E. coli (MIC 34 ug/ml). More active against a mutant strain from the mprF regulating system ( Li et al., 2007 ).
